Girls And Boys is a song originally by Good Charlotte from their 2002 album, The Young and the Hopeless. It was sung by Aldy Williams in Ch-Ch-Changes as both his answer to Will's question about what Valentine's Day is about as well as a shot at his ex-girlfriend, Taylor Atkinson, and his rival, Miles Larson's relationship.
